1.1 Making Your Course Available to Students
The first thing you must do on the first day of a new semester is make your course available for students. Students expect to access their courses in Blackboard first thing in the morning on the first day of class. However, the process is not automatic--only you have the power to “turn on” your course for students.
To make your course available, go to the green box labeled Control Panel, located at the bottom left of your Course Menu.

Click Customization, and then choose Properties.
The options on the Properties menu are automatically set when your courses are created each semester. The only option on this menu that needs your attention is #3, Set Availability. This setting asks, “Make this course available?” and by default, the answer “No” is selected. You must click the radio button next to “Yes” to make your course available for students on the first day of class.
Once you have selected Yes, scroll to the bottom of the page and click Submit. Your course is now available for students.
At the very latest, you should make your course available by 9 AM on the first day of a new semester. Students begin calling and emailing LSSC’s Helpdesk early on the first day of class if they do not see their courses listed in Blackboard. Helpdesk staff will direct students to email their instructors to inquire about when the course will become available, and will alert the instructor and his department chair if the course is not made available by the second day of class.
